Output efc4de46188026b3c8f6a71b52d39520cf7fe0dd1310961ec17b8ebfb398dbdf:50

value
261015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3db8fafe87c0962e3c49aa53bee66fa3dfe78353 OP_EQUAL
address
37KNjurhadLAzUfdGTGiqXYs4VMgYzzhR7
transaction
efc4de46188026b3c8f6a71b52d39520cf7fe0dd1310961ec17b8ebfb398dbdf
spent
true